Output fea2695d0f8150a4267c0b57deaff9900d44d332bd2478f12ea9535466029239:12

value
639959300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a003a0ae2152b996d00bb16a9f50108844ef5b OP_EQUAL
address
MXCnEKtM7Cxabs3qQkHNGSLk5eKSESrZEi
transaction
fea2695d0f8150a4267c0b57deaff9900d44d332bd2478f12ea9535466029239
spent
true